Title Transcription profiling of tomato responding to Fusarium oxysporum
Relevance Agricultural
Data types Transcriptome or Gene expression
Raw sequence reads
Organisms Solanum lycopersicum
Description As exploring gene expression and function approaches constitute an initial point for investigating pathogen host interaction, we performed RNA-seq and sRNA-seq analysis to unravel regulated genes and miRNAs in tomato infected by FOL. Our data will offer the community with a future direction and surely help in generating models of mediated resistance responses with assessment of genomic gene expression patterns.
